Among freelators operating on Polish lands, as well as in abroad lodges, we can find representatives of the Roman Catholic clergy; both high-ranking hierarchs and average priests or monks. This was not a large representation, the most (a fewer twelve people) belonged in the first period, that is, to the liquidation of the masonry in 1821.
Among them were specified prominent figures as the primate and the diocesan bishop.
The clergy of another Christian denominations did not lack, either, but they were incidents and were mainly representatives of Evangelical churches.
As a reminder: the first free-growing organizations appeared in the territory of the Republic of Poland as early as the 18th century, and the emergence of the Red Brotherhood in 1720 or 1721 can be assumed as their beginnings. But we know small about him, for the life of this structure was comparatively short. It is possible that the Brotherhood was related to Jacobic Masonry, or free-mural structures
created by Catholic English and Irish emigrants from the British Isles in any continental European countries. Their main goal was to return to the throne of the Catholic Stuart dynasty.
We have more information about the 3 brothers lodge created in Warsaw in 1729 and so this year is considered the beginning of the Royal Art in Poland. During the reign of King Stanislaw August Poniatowski, in the Duchy of Warsaw and in the first years of functioning of the Kingdom of Poland, the masonry experienced its top flourish.
The hostility of the Catholic Church to freemulation did not happen immediately, and this was due to purely cyclical causes. As I mentioned earlier, emigrants from the Islands who wanted the return of Stuarts played a major function in its development; they established lodges in Catholic countries specified as France, Spain, Poland or in the very centre of the Church State – Rome. For respective decades Papacy had been actively active in actions organized in defence of the challenger to the throne of British James II Stuart and his son, so it was kind to treat the improvement of the Jacobites. The Stuarts received the title of Catholic Kings of England from the pope, and the wife of James III, granddaughter of King John III Sobieski Clementine, title of Catholic Queen of England.
